Kaibab Historic Logging Railroad Interpretive Trail

Kaibab National Forest Coconino, Arizona Williams Ranger District

This project proposes to designate an interpretive trail along a 3.67 mile stretch of historic railroad grade on the Williams Ranger District which was used for logging in the late 1800s.

Location

Just east of Sherwood Forest Estates, South to the 141 Road
